Inner geometry and embedding formulas for a totally geodesic null hypersurface ℳ in an electrovacuum space-time are given. The structure of all possible symmetry groups of the geometry is described in case that the space-like sections ℊ and ℳ are compact orientable surfaces and ℳ is, topologically, ℊ × R 1. The result is MediaObjects/220_2005_BF01646541_f1.tif , where MediaObjects/220_2005_BF01646541_f2.tif are the well-known isometry groups of ℊ, and ℋ is an at most two-dimensional group acting along rays, which is fully specified in the paper. It is not shown that all these symmetry types exist, but this will be done in the next papers where all horizons of a given symmetry type will be explicitly written down.
